The United Kingdom (UK) Coatings Raw Materials Market was estimated at USD 349 Million in 2025 and is projected to reach USD 430 Million by 2032, growing at a CAGR of 3.0% from 2026 to 2032. This anticipated growth is propelled by robust demand from key industries, particularly construction and automotive, which increasingly require high-performance coatings. Furthermore, the shift towards eco-friendly materials aligns with evolving consumer preferences and regulatory frameworks aimed at reducing environmental impacts.

Recently, the UK coatings raw materials market has witnessed considerable momentum, driven primarily by rising infrastructure projects and increasing automotive production. However, as the landscape evolves, there is an increasing emphasis on sustainable solutions, necessitating a significant shift in sourcing and product formulation strategies.
Looking ahead, the market is expected to transition further towards innovations in raw materials, particularly those that meet stringent environmental standards. This not only reflects consumer demands but also aligns with government initiatives aimed at promoting eco-friendly practices across various sectors.
Despite its growth potential, the UK coatings raw materials market faces several restraints. Fluctuations in global supply chains and currency exchange rates have led to increased raw material costs, affecting the overall profitability for manufacturers. Additionally, navigating regulatory changes can pose challenges as companies strive to comply with evolving environmental standards. These factors necessitate strategic adaptability among market players to sustain competitive advantage and ensure long-term growth.
One of the most significant trends in the UK coatings raw materials market is the rising demand for sustainable and eco-friendly products. As regulatory pressures increase and consumers shift towards greener alternatives, manufacturers are investing in the development of bio-based resins and high-performance coatings that not only minimize environmental impact but also enhance durability and performance.

Government policies in the UK are increasingly oriented towards fostering sustainability within the coatings raw materials market. Legislation such as REACH emphasizes the need for safe chemical practices, while various initiatives aim to reduce carbon emissions. The UK government is also investing in research programs that promote the use of environmentally-friendly materials, encouraging industry stakeholders to adapt to these evolving standards.
